General Information
| Work Title | 6 Romances |
|---|---|
| Alternative Title | 6 романсов (6 romansov) |
| Composer | Tchaikovsky, Pyotr Ilyich |
|---|---|
| Opus/Catalogue Number | Op.57, TH 105 |
| Number of Movements/Sections | 6 |
| Average Duration | 17 minutes |
| Year/Date of Composition | 1884 |
| Year of First Publication | 1885 |
| Librettist | No.1 — Vladimir Alexandrovich Sollogub (1813–1882) No.2 — Alexey Konstantinovich Tolstoy (1817–1875) No.3 — Aleksandr Nikolayevich Strugovoshchikov (1809–1878), after Johann Wolfgang von Goethe (1749–1832) Nos.4 and 5 — Dmitry Sergeyevich Merezhkovsky (1865–1941) No.6 — Alexey Nikolayevich Pleshcheyev (1825–1893), after Ada Christen (1844–1901) |
| Language | Russian |
| Dedication | No.1 — Fyodor Komissarshevsky No.2 — Bogomir Korsov (1843–1920) No.3 — Emiliya Pavlovskaya (1853–1935) No.4 — Vera Butakova (1843–1923) No.5 — Dmitry Usatov No.6 — Alexandra Krutikova |
| Genre | Song cycle |
| Piece Style | Romantic |
| Instrumentation | Voice + Piano |
